Suffer the Little Children

- Child Migration and the Geopolitics of Compassion in the United States

About Suffer the Little Children

In this affecting and innovative global history - starting with the European children who fled the perils of World War II and ending with the Central American children who arrive every day at the US southern border - Anita Casavantes Bradford traces the evolution of American policy toward unaccompanied children.
